[svn-commits] tilghman: trunk r179361 -	/trunk/cdr/cdr_sqlite3_custom.c
    SVN commits to the Digium repositories 
    svn-commits at lists.digium.com
       
    Mon Mar  2 11:18:51 CST 2009
    
    
  
Author: tilghman
Date: Mon Mar  2 11:18:48 2009
New Revision: 179361
URL: http://svn.digium.com/svn-view/asterisk?view=rev&rev=179361
Log:
Backport 1.6.0 fix to trunk (failsafe if db is not loaded)
Modified:
    trunk/cdr/cdr_sqlite3_custom.c
Modified: trunk/cdr/cdr_sqlite3_custom.c
URL: http://svn.digium.com/svn-view/asterisk/trunk/cdr/cdr_sqlite3_custom.c?view=diff&rev=179361&r1=179360&r2=179361
==============================================================================
--- trunk/cdr/cdr_sqlite3_custom.c (original)
+++ trunk/cdr/cdr_sqlite3_custom.c Mon Mar  2 11:18:48 2009
@@ -239,6 +239,11 @@
 	char *sql = NULL;
 	struct ast_channel dummy = { 0, };
 	int count = 0;
+
+	if (db == NULL) {
+		/* Should not have loaded, but be failsafe. */
+		return 0;
+	}
 
 	{ /* Make it obvious that only sql should be used outside of this block */
 		char *escaped;
    
    
More information about the svn-commits
mailing list